Pastor’s Column


Grace and Peace to you, 

Jesus, in John 14:27 says, “Peace I leave with you, My peace I give to you; not as the world gives do I give to you. Let not your heart be troubled, neither let it be afraid.” 

If we were to search throug this simple phrase, we could find gold nuggets of wisdom that will last beyond any trial or tribulation that may come our way.  Notice Jesus commends to us, peace.  This however is not just any peace, but “My peace”.

Often we seek places of tranquility in order to get away from the noise and pressure from this world.  However, Jesus is clear that the world may offer a tranquility that does not “surpass all understanding”.  What the Lord is encouraging here is to find a place “in Him” where no trouble of the world can disturb or disrupt.    

 Are you resting “in Christ”?  Are all your hopes and joys “in Christ”?  Does your peace come from that place “in Christ”?  If not, seek the place “in Christ” where peace goes undisturbed and uninterrupted.

What is?    
Local Church 
  “The most significant arena through which disciple-making occurs”. 2012 Book of Discipline (BOD)
  “Under the guidance of the Holy Spirit (helps) people to accept and confess Jesus Christ as Lord and Savior and to live out their daily lives in light of their relationship with God” (BOD).   Where laity hold membership.   
District
May bring churches in a region together in shared mission or ministry. District superintendent provides leadership. Grace UMC Arlington is part of the East District.
Annual Conference 
The primary link to the church’s connectional structure. Local churches are organized into annual conferences, regional bodies that meet yearly for legislative purposes. Each annual conference has an equal number of lay and clergy members. 
  (Adapted from Let’s Go Fishing United Methodist Handbook)
